目录

    工业企业设备管理系统开发:助力工业企业实现高效设备管理与智能运维

    • 来源:建米软件
    • 2025-08-07 09:49:42
    

    工业企业设备管理系统的开发对于提升工业企业的设备管理效率、降低成本、保障生产安全等方面具有至关重要的意义。一个完善的设备管理系统能够帮助企业实现设备全生命周期的管理,包括设备采购、安装调试、运行维护、维修保养、报废处理等各个环节,提高设备的可靠性和利用率,从而增强企业的核心竞争力。以下将详细介绍工业企业设备管理系统开发的相关要点。

    一、开发前的需求调研

    1. 与企业各部门沟通

    和生产部门交流,了解他们在日常生产中对设备的使用情况,如设备的操作流程、使用频率、常见故障等。与维修部门沟通,掌握设备维修的历史数据、维修周期、维修成本等信息。和采购部门探讨设备采购的标准、流程以及供应商信息。

    2. 实地考察设备

    到企业的生产现场实地查看设备的运行状况,观察设备的布局、连接方式、工作环境等。记录设备的型号、规格、生产厂家等详细信息,以便在系统中准确地对设备进行管理。

    3. 分析企业现有管理模式

    研究企业当前的设备管理模式,包括管理制度、工作流程、人员职责等。找出其中存在的问题和不足之处,如管理流程繁琐、信息传递不及时等,为系统开发提供改进的方向。

    4. 收集行业标准和法规

    了解行业内关于设备管理的相关标准和法规,确保开发的系统符合行业要求。例如,某些行业对设备的安全性能、环保指标等有严格的规定,系统需要能够对这些方面进行有效的管理和监控。

    5. 确定系统功能需求

    根据以上调研结果,明确系统需要具备的功能,如设备档案管理、维修计划制定、故障预警、备件管理等。将功能需求进行详细的整理和分类,为后续的系统设计提供依据。

    二、系统架构设计

    1. 确定系统整体架构

    选择合适的系统架构,如分层架构、微服务架构等。分层架构可以将系统分为表示层、业务逻辑层和数据访问层,使系统的结构更加清晰,便于开发和维护。微服务架构则将系统拆分成多个小型的、自治的服务,提高系统的可扩展性和灵活性。

    2. 设计数据库架构

    根据系统的功能需求,设计合理的数据库架构。确定数据库的表结构、字段定义、数据关系等。例如,设计设备信息表、维修记录表、备件库存表等,确保数据的存储和管理高效、准确。

    3. 规划系统接口

    考虑系统与其他企业信息系统的接口,如ERP系统、MES系统等。制定接口规范,确保系统之间能够实现数据的共享和交互。例如,与ERP系统接口可以实现设备采购信息的同步,与MES系统接口可以获取设备的实时运行数据。

    4. 选择开发技术和工具

    根据系统架构和功能需求,选择合适的开发技术和工具。例如,前端可以使用HTML、CSS、JavaScript等技术,后端可以选择Java、Python等编程语言,数据库可以选用MySQL、Oracle等。

    5. 进行性能优化设计

    在系统架构设计阶段就考虑性能优化问题,如采用缓存技术、优化数据库查询语句等。确保系统在高并发情况下能够稳定运行,提高系统的响应速度和处理能力。

    三、功能模块开发

    1. 设备档案管理模块

    实现设备基本信息的录入、修改和查询功能。包括设备的名称、型号、规格、生产厂家、购置日期等。为每台设备建立唯一的档案,方便对设备进行全生命周期的管理。

    2. 维修管理模块

    可以制定维修计划,安排维修任务。记录维修过程中的详细信息,如维修时间、维修人员、维修内容、更换的备件等。对维修成本进行统计和分析,为企业的维修决策提供依据。

    3. 故障预警模块

    通过对设备运行数据的实时监测,设置合理的预警阈值。当设备运行参数超出阈值时,系统自动发出预警信息,提醒维修人员及时处理,避免设备故障的发生。

    4. 备件管理模块

    管理备件的库存信息,包括备件的名称、数量、单价、存放位置等。实现备件的采购、入库、出库等操作的管理。根据设备的维修需求,合理安排备件的库存,降低库存成本。

    5. 统计分析模块

    对设备的运行数据、维修数据、备件数据等进行统计和分析。生成各种报表和图表,如设备故障率统计报表、维修成本分析图表等,为企业的管理层提供决策支持。

    四、系统测试与优化

    1. 功能测试

    对系统的各个功能模块进行详细的测试,确保功能的正确性和完整性。检查设备档案管理模块是否能够准确录入和查询设备信息,维修管理模块是否能够正常安排维修任务和记录维修信息等。

    2. 性能测试

    模拟高并发的使用场景,测试系统的性能指标,如响应时间、吞吐量等。通过性能测试发现系统存在的性能瓶颈,如数据库查询缓慢、服务器负载过高等问题,并进行针对性的优化。

    3. 安全测试

    检查系统的安全性,包括数据加密、用户认证、访问控制等方面。防止系统受到黑客攻击、数据泄露等安全威胁。例如,对用户的登录密码进行加密处理,设置不同用户的访问权限。

    4. 兼容性测试

    测试系统在不同的操作系统、浏览器、设备上的兼容性。确保系统能够在各种环境下正常运行,为用户提供一致的使用体验。

    5. 根据测试结果优化系统

    对测试过程中发现的问题进行及时修复和优化。对系统的代码进行优化,提高系统的性能和稳定性。对系统的功能进行完善,满足用户的实际需求。

    测试类型 测试内容 测试目的
    功能测试 检查系统各功能模块的正确性和完整性 确保系统功能符合需求
    性能测试 模拟高并发场景,测试响应时间、吞吐量等 发现性能瓶颈并优化
    安全测试 检查数据加密、用户认证、访问控制等 保障系统安全

    五、用户培训与上线部署

    1. 制定培训计划

    根据系统的功能和用户的角色,制定详细的培训计划。针对不同的用户群体,如生产人员、维修人员、管理人员等,设计不同的培训内容。

    2. 开展培训课程

    采用线上线下相结合的方式开展培训课程。线上可以提供视频教程、在线文档等资源,方便用户随时学习。线下可以组织面对面的培训讲座和实操演练,让用户更加直观地掌握系统的使用方法。

    3. 上线前的准备工作

    完成系统的部署和配置,确保系统能够正常运行。将企业的设备数据、人员信息等导入到系统中。进行上线前的最后一次测试,确保系统的稳定性和安全性。

    4. 系统上线

    选择合适的时间正式上线系统。在上线初期,安排专人进行技术支持,及时解决用户在使用过程中遇到的问题。

    5. 收集用户反馈

    上线后,及时收集用户的反馈意见。了解用户对系统的满意度和使用过程中存在的问题,为系统的后续优化提供依据。

    六、系统的维护与更新

    1. 日常系统监控

    建立系统监控机制,实时监测系统的运行状态。包括服务器的性能指标、数据库的连接情况、系统的响应时间等。及时发现系统运行过程中出现的异常情况,并进行处理。

    2. 数据备份与恢复

    定期对系统的数据进行备份,防止数据丢失。制定数据恢复方案,在数据出现问题时能够快速恢复数据,确保系统的正常运行。

    3. 安全漏洞修复

    关注系统的安全问题,及时修复发现的安全漏洞。定期更新系统的安全补丁,防止系统受到黑客攻击。

    4. 功能更新与扩展

    根据企业的发展和用户的需求,对系统的功能进行更新和扩展。例如,增加新的设备管理功能、优化统计分析模块等,提高系统的实用性和竞争力。

    5. 与用户保持沟通

    与用户建立良好的沟通渠道,及时了解用户的新需求和意见。根据用户的反馈,不断改进系统的功能和性能,提高用户的满意度。

    七、系统集成与数据共享

    1. 与企业其他信息系统集成

    将设备管理系统与企业的ERP系统、MES系统等进行集成。实现数据的共享和业务流程的协同。例如,设备管理系统可以从ERP系统获取设备采购信息,将维修成本数据反馈给ERP系统。

    2. 数据接口开发

    开发系统与其他系统之间的数据接口,确保数据的准确传输和交互。制定接口规范,保证接口的稳定性和兼容性。

    3. 数据清洗与转换

    对不同系统之间的数据进行清洗和转换,确保数据的一致性和准确性。例如,将不同系统中设备名称的不同表述进行统一。

    4. 建立数据共享平台

    搭建数据共享平台,实现企业内部各系统之间的数据共享。通过数据共享平台,企业的管理层可以获取更全面、准确的信息,为决策提供支持。

    5. 保障数据安全

    在数据共享过程中,要重视数据的安全问题。采取数据加密、访问控制等措施,防止数据泄露和滥用。

    集成系统 集成内容 集成目的
    ERP系统 设备采购信息、维修成本数据 实现业务流程协同和数据共享
    MES系统 设备运行数据 实时掌握设备状态,优化生产调度
    其他系统 根据实际需求确定 满足企业整体信息化需求

    八、持续改进与创新

    1. 关注行业动态

    密切关注工业企业设备管理领域的最新技术和发展趋势。了解行业内其他企业在设备管理系统开发和应用方面的成功经验,为自身系统的改进提供参考。

    2. 引入新技术

    适时引入新技术,如人工智能、大数据、物联网等。利用人工智能技术实现设备故障的智能诊断,通过大数据分析挖掘设备运行数据中的潜在价值,借助物联网技术实现设备的远程监控和管理。

    3. 鼓励用户参与改进

    鼓励用户积极参与系统的改进和创新。设立用户反馈渠道,收集用户的意见和建议。对提出有价值建议的用户给予奖励,提高用户参与的积极性。

    4. 定期评估系统效果

    定期对系统的运行效果进行评估。分析系统对企业设备管理效率、成本控制、生产安全等方面的影响。根据评估结果,确定系统的改进方向和重点。

    5. 开展创新实践

    在系统开发和应用过程中,积极开展创新实践。尝试新的管理模式和方法,不断探索提高设备管理水平的新途径。通过持续改进和创新,使系统始终保持领先地位,为企业的发展提供有力支持。

    工业企业设备管理系统的开发是一个复杂的过程,需要从需求调研、架构设计、功能开发、测试优化到维护更新等各个环节进行精心策划和实施。要注重系统的集成与数据共享,持续改进和创新,以满足企业不断变化的需求,提升企业的设备管理水平和核心竞争力。


    常见用户关注的问题:

    一、工业企业设备管理系统开发要多少钱啊?

    我就想知道开发一个工业企业设备管理系统得花多少钱呢,毕竟企业都得考虑成本嘛。下面来详细说说可能影响价格的因素。

    功能复杂度

    如果系统只是简单的设备信息记录和查询功能,那价格相对较低。但要是包含设备维护计划制定、故障预警、数据分析等复杂功能,开发成本就会大幅上升。比如说,故障预警功能需要涉及大量的算法和数据模型,开发难度大,成本自然高。

    定制化程度

    完全定制开发的系统,要根据企业的特殊需求来设计,从架构到界面都要量身打造,价格肯定比使用通用模板的系统贵很多。通用模板虽然便宜,但可能无法完全满足企业的个性化需求。

    开发团队

    不同地区、不同规模的开发团队收费标准不同。一线城市的知名开发团队,由于人力成本高、技术实力强,收费会比较高。而一些小型团队或者个人开发者,价格可能相对较低,但质量和售后可能无法保证。

    系统平台

    开发一个只在电脑端使用的系统和开发一个支持移动端、电脑端多平台使用的系统,价格是不一样的。多平台开发需要考虑不同平台的兼容性,开发工作量增加,费用也会相应提高。

    数据安全

    工业企业的设备数据通常很重要,对数据安全要求高。如果系统需要采用高级的数据加密技术、安全防护机制,开发成本会增加。比如采用银行级别的数据加密,会增加不少开发费用。

    后期维护

    开发完成后,系统还需要进行后期维护和更新。维护费用也是一笔不小的开支,包括系统故障修复、功能升级等。有些开发团队会提供一定期限的免费维护,之后再收取费用。

    二、工业企业设备管理系统开发得多久能完成?

    我听说很多企业都着急用设备管理系统,所以都想知道开发这个系统得多久。下面就来分析一下影响开发时间的因素。

    项目规划

    前期的项目规划很重要,如果规划不清晰,需求不断变更,会大大延长开发时间。比如一开始没确定好系统要实现哪些功能,开发过程中又不断增加新功能,就会导致工期延长。

    功能模块数量

    系统的功能模块越多,开发时间就越长。像设备采购管理、设备运行监控、设备报废管理等多个模块,每个模块都需要进行设计、开发和测试,时间自然就长了。

    技术难度

    如果系统采用了一些先进的技术,如物联网技术、大数据分析技术等,开发难度大,开发时间也会增加。因为开发团队需要花费时间去研究和掌握这些新技术。

    团队协作

    开发团队成员之间的协作效率也会影响开发时间。如果团队沟通不畅,成员之间配合不默契,会导致开发进度缓慢。比如开发人员和测试人员之间信息传递不及时,就会耽误时间。

    测试环节

    系统开发完成后,需要进行严格的测试,确保系统没有漏洞和问题。测试过程中发现的问题需要及时修复,这也会占用一定的时间。如果系统规模大,测试时间会更长。

    外部因素

    一些外部因素,如供应商提供的技术支持不及时、服务器故障等,也可能影响开发进度。比如服务器出现问题,导致开发环境无法正常使用,就会耽误开发时间。

    三、工业企业设备管理系统开发有啥好处啊?

    我想知道工业企业开发设备管理系统到底能带来啥好处呢,下面就来详细说说。

    提高设备利用率

    通过系统可以实时监控设备的运行状态,合理安排设备的使用计划,避免设备闲置和过度使用。比如根据设备的运行数据,提前安排维护,减少设备故障停机时间,提高设备的使用效率。

    降低维护成本

    系统可以制定科学的维护计划,根据设备的实际运行情况进行维护,避免不必要的维护。通过对设备故障的预警和分析,可以快速定位故障原因,减少维修时间和成本。

    提升管理效率

    传统的设备管理方式需要大量的人工记录和统计,效率低下。而设备管理系统可以实现设备信息的自动化管理,快速查询和统计设备数据,提高管理效率。

    保障生产安全

    系统可以对设备的运行参数进行实时监测,当参数超出正常范围时及时发出预警,避免设备发生安全事故。比如监测设备的温度、压力等参数,确保设备在安全的状态下运行。

    优化决策

    系统可以对设备的运行数据进行分析,为企业的决策提供依据。比如通过分析设备的维修成本和使用寿命,决定是否需要更换设备。

    实现信息共享

    不同部门可以通过系统共享设备信息,提高部门之间的协作效率。比如生产部门可以及时了解设备的维护情况,合理安排生产计划。

    影响因素 具体表现 对开发的影响
    功能复杂度 简单功能或复杂功能 复杂功能增加成本和时间
    定制化程度 完全定制或通用模板 定制化增加成本和时间
    开发团队 不同地区和规模 一线城市知名团队收费高

    四、工业企业设备管理系统开发用啥技术好呢?

    朋友说现在技术发展得很快,开发工业企业设备管理系统有好多技术可以选,我就想知道用啥技术好呢。

    前端技术

    HTML、CSS、JavaScript是前端开发的基础技术,可以构建系统的用户界面。现在流行的前端框架如Vue.js、React.js等,可以提高开发效率,让界面更加美观和交互性强。

    后端技术

    常见的后端开发语言有Java、Python、.NET等。Java具有良好的跨平台性和稳定性,适合大型企业级应用开发。Python则以其简洁的语法和丰富的库,在数据分析和人工智能方面有优势。

    数据库技术

    关系型数据库如MySQL、Oracle等,适合存储结构化的数据,如设备信息、维护记录等。非关系型数据库如MongoDB、Redis等,适合存储非结构化的数据,如设备的实时运行数据。

    物联网技术

    如果系统需要实现设备的远程监控和控制,就需要用到物联网技术。如MQTT协议可以实现设备与系统之间的通信,传感器技术可以采集设备的运行数据。

    大数据技术

    工业企业的设备会产生大量的数据,大数据技术可以对这些数据进行存储、处理和分析。如Hadoop、Spark等大数据框架,可以帮助企业挖掘数据价值。

    人工智能技术

    人工智能技术可以用于设备故障预警、设备性能预测等。如机器学习算法可以根据设备的历史数据建立模型,预测设备的故障概率。

    五、工业企业设备管理系统开发咋找靠谱的团队啊?

    假如你要开发工业企业设备管理系统,肯定想找个靠谱的团队,下面就来说说怎么找。

    查看案例

    让开发团队提供他们之前开发过的类似项目案例,看看系统的功能、界面、稳定性等方面是否符合自己的需求。通过实际案例可以了解团队的开发实力。

    了解经验

    了解开发团队在工业企业设备管理系统开发方面的经验。有丰富经验的团队,对行业需求和技术难点有更深入的了解,开发出的系统质量更有保障。

    考察技术实力

    可以通过与团队成员交流,了解他们掌握的技术和开发工具。看看团队是否具备开发复杂系统的技术能力,如是否熟悉物联网、大数据等技术。

    查看口碑

    在网上搜索开发团队的口碑,看看其他客户对他们的评价。也可以向同行打听,了解他们合作过的开发团队的情况。

    沟通能力

    开发过程中需要与团队进行频繁的沟通,所以团队的沟通能力很重要。一个沟通顺畅的团队,可以更好地理解企业的需求,及时解决开发过程中出现的问题。

    售后服务

    了解开发团队提供的售后服务内容,如系统维护、故障修复、功能升级等。好的售后服务可以保证系统的长期稳定运行。

    寻找途径 具体方法 优势
    查看案例 要求提供类似项目案例 了解开发实力
    了解经验 询问在行业的开发经验 保障系统质量
    考察技术实力 与团队成员交流技术 确保能开发复杂系统

    预约免费体验 让管理无忧

    微信咨询

    扫码获取服务 扫码获取服务

    添加专属销售顾问

    扫码获取一对一服务